Population Density
The population density of Cedmont in 2022 was 7,227 people per square mile. This density indicates an urbanized area with mixed housing types.
Cedmont experienced population fluctuations from 2010 to 2022. The highest population was 3,212 residents in 2019, and the lowest was 2,533 residents in 2017.
Recent data shows a slight increase from 2,687 in 2021 to 2,688 in 2022, following a decline from 2,941 in 2020.
The neighborhood had an estimated 1,030 housing units in 2022. The average household size is likely close to the national average of 2.61 persons.
